I am really big on classroom community and having a community of learners in the classroom, so I will cultivate social groups by putting desks in small groups and having the children work in small group centers together. We will have rules for everyone's benefit and learning. For example, our goal in the classroom everyday will be to be learners together. If two children are arguing, I may have a conversation with them about how in order to be learners together, we need to get along and ask them some ways that they could work toward that together or that I could help them get along.
